Life in Cheswick

Cheswick is one of northwest Solon's officially recognized subdivisions, built around Cheswick Drive, Cheswick Place, and connecting streets like Lansdowne Drive and Stansbury Drive. It's a well-established neighborhood that continues to see strong, steady buyer interest year after year.
The homes throughout Cheswick reflect a mix of construction eras across its several development phases, giving buyers options that range from classic Solon colonials to more recently updated homes with modern finishes.
Cheswick's location in northwest Solon puts residents close to the city's business corridor and within easy reach of I-422 and Route 91, while still feeling like a quiet residential pocket. The neighborhood is zoned to Solon City Schools.
Recent MLS activity shows Cheswick among Solon's highest-turnover neighborhoods, with 9 recent sales and an average sold price of approximately $522,156.
